What Are Nik Naks?

Nik Naks are a maize-based savoury snack known for their irregular shape and crunchy texture. Rather than having the thin, flat appearance associated with conventional potato crisps, they have a more unusual structure that gives every bite a characteristic crunch. Their seasoned coating adds another dimension, creating the strong savoury taste that many snack enthusiasts associate with the product.

The unusual design is one of the reasons these snacks are so easy to recognise. When placed beside ordinary crisps, their shape immediately catches the eye and suggests a different eating experience. The combination of crunch, seasoning and distinctive appearance has helped establish a clear identity within the British snack market, making them a familiar choice for casual occasions.

Nik Naks Compared With Other Crisps

Traditional potato crisps are usually thin and flat, while Nik Naks have a distinctive maize-based structure and irregular shape. This difference creates a separate texture and eating experience. Traditional crisps often emphasise the combination of potato and seasoning, whereas Nik Naks are particularly recognised for their crunchy structure and pronounced savoury character.

Other maize-based snacks may share some manufacturing characteristics, but each product has its own shape, seasoning and branding. The individuality of Nik Naks has helped them develop a recognisable position within the market. For consumers, the choice often comes down to personal preference, including whether they prefer a traditional crisp, a lighter crunchy snack or something with a more unusual texture.
